The insurance sector as of September 30, 2025, amounted to KGS 7,465.35 million (EUR 72.85 million), which is 99.88% more y-o-y, as data published by the Service for regulation and supervision of the financial market of Kyrgyzstan show.
Mandatory insurance makes up the largest share in the market premium portfolio (35.95%), followed by property and personal insurance. Growth was observed across all lines of business, except for liability and life insurance.
A significant increase in mandatory insurance, particularly in MTPL (2.2 times), indicates expansion of the insurance system's coverage.
The volume of ceded reinsurance premiums increased to KGS 1,334.6 million (+4.6%), according to the insurance market report for the first nine months of 2025, published by the Service for regulation and supervision of the financial market of Kyrgyzstan. Moreover, the share of domestic reinsurance (within the country) increased to KGS 255.5 million (+65.3%), reflecting strengthening of the domestic insurance market and reduced dependence on foreign reinsurers.
According to the report, total number of insurance contracts reached 2.58 million units (+35%), which indicates widespread involvement of individuals and businesses in insurance. The regulator noted that 2.58 million insurance contracts is a new record for the Kyrgyz insurance market.
As of September 30, 2025, total paid claims amounted to KGS 877.12 million (+60.17% y-o-y)/EUR 8.56 million.
The sector’s total assets increased by 13.6% to KGS 14.98 billion. Total equity rose by 28.8%, reflecting strengthening of companies' financial stability. ROA increased from 4% to 6%, and ROE from 9% to 9.2%, demonstrating effective asset management.
As of September 30, 2025, 15 insurers were active in the market. GSO holds the lead, with a 25.33% market share. It is followed by ARSENAL Kyrgyzstan and NSK. The top three composition remained unchanged compared to the same period last year.
